Transaction 86a5860c295a55c21a31fd132d2a2fc7727a80245589069076534233959eb3ba

1 Input
2 Outputs
  • 86a5860c295a55c21a31fd132d2a2fc7727a80245589069076534233959eb3ba:0
  • value  36434
    address  19zcbxHuVmhBQ9UWk9uUh5kWrAET1BrrxU
  • 86a5860c295a55c21a31fd132d2a2fc7727a80245589069076534233959eb3ba:1
  • value  1548600
    address  1GTFHxHj4pY5LWEjbB6U3a3R2Zgq6kZT4E